The single Linea shelf (5801) is excellent on its own or combined with other Linea shelves to create a wall system that fits your needs. Perfect for storing books, displaying objects, or dividing a room, this narrow shelf offers both open and closed storage. Mix and match shelves to create your perfect display and storage solution.
A Slim Solution
The 5801 makes excellent use of vertical space, ideal for tight or limited spaces where extra storage is needed.Versatility
Making an ideal wall system, Linea Shelving can also be used to create a room divider, securely anchoring to a wall on one end.Durability
Polished tempered glass shelves provide a clean and modern look while being durable enough to support a library of books and a lifetime of treasures.
Cord Control
Linea shelves include a generous cutout on the bottom shelf of the enclosed cabinet that allows for convenient cord connections and out-of-sight cable management.- Open Display Shelves

Matthew Weatherly
Matthew Weatherly is BDI's Associate Design Director. A graduate of the prestigious Royal Danish Academy of Fine arts and Pratt Institute, Weatherly is most well-known for BDI's popular Corridor, Tanami, Sequel, and Centro designs.
"My studies in Denmark had the most significant impact on my design aesthetic. I was fortunate to have Erling Christoffersen as my professor, and he introduced me to the works of Danish Modern designers. Arne Jacobsen, Børge Mogensen, Poul Kjærholm, Finn Juhl, Poul Henningsen, and Hans Wegner are among the most influential designers to me."
- Matt Weatherly
